Great company to make an impact

Anonymous employee
Recommend
CEO approval
Business Outlook

Pros

Having worked at a few companies in the Boston area Indigo stands out as the place where I can make the greatest impact on my team and for the org. The work is really rewarding and the mission of the company is undeniably motivating. A lot of opportunity for growth and mobility internally on most teams. Leadership is transparent and very open to discussion and questions. Company is putting in a lot of effort to building a more diverse team and connect with the community.

Cons

As the company is growing there can be a lot of shifts and reprioritizing in your day to day, typical of a lot of start ups, but not for those who thrive in routine. Benefits are good on the healthcare level, but have room for improvement otherwise.
